1998-07-04 Chris Lahey <clahey@umich.edu>
* src/Makefile.am (bin_PROGRAMS): Added test-format to compile the
formatting tests.
* src/format.c (format_time): Added date formatting.
(format_text): More accurate numeric formatting.
1998-07-03 Chris Lahey <clahey@umich.edu>
* src/format.c: New file to do excel style number formatting.
